Flippin’ Eck Children’s Musicals can help you raise funds for your school, college, children’s group, youth group, community group or adult drama group and to support an HIV/Aids Children’s project in Africa. Materials are designed to be easily understood. We would like to help make your production successful by keeping charges to an absolute minimum to cover our costs of production and distribution.

The Performance Licence Fee is included in the purchase price of all materials. All Performance Licence Fees received are donated to HIV/AIDS children’s projects in Africa. A licence for five performances is included in the cost of a production package or score and we allow you to photocopy or reproduce our lyrics to create song-sheets or overhead transparencies to facilitate the staging and educational use of each performance.
